When I first started, I wanted to have the eQSL indicated my ACL logbook, so I would manually enter it (I used an "E" to show a QSL from eQSL). But, that was a pain, so I don't bother anymore. In fact, I actually don't want it in my ACL logbook, because basically, the ARRL doesn't accept any eQSLs for awards, anyway. Having the eQSL in ACL makes it difficult to tell if I have a legitimate QSL in the eyes of the ARRL. I still upload my contacts to eQSL, but I only use it as a "nice to know" reference.
If someone doesn't use LoTW, and I need their QSL for DXCC ( WAS, etc), then I send them an old fashion QSL card, and wait to get one in return. The only time I indicate that I have received a QSL in ACL, is if it is from LoTW, or a paper QSL. |
